Most autos will flower at some point between 4 and 7 weeks. We’ve seen a few of them go as long as 12 weeks before flowering.

Photos only flower based on the lighting schedule and won’t flower until your change the light schedule to 12 on / 12 off.

Autos don’t care what the light schedule is. They flower automatically when they are sexually mature.

Gotcha, reason i ask is that in week 5 theyll start to bulk up. The pistils will turn red, recede, and good chance new pistils will emerge. Sorta like a cycle. Just gotta wait and see.
